I'm curious what all of you 001/PTLE owners (or potential owners) think of the Waves plugins. I would really be interested to hear from Logic 4.0/001 users, as that (and a Sony DPS-55 efx box) is pretty much my frame of reference for quality in plugins.
I keep hearing that the Logic plugins are considered pretty good and probably better than those bundled with PTLE, or any other sequencer or editing program. They sound pretty good to me, but like I said I have a limited frame of reference, having not used much else. The Waves plugins are starting to look really good to me on paper, but how good are they really? There is a lot of things they can do that Logic's plugins can't do, but there also ought to be a significant jump in quality seeing as how the Waves bundle costs twice as much as Logic Platinum including its plugins. What do you guys/gals think? 'Cat |
